There are many in our community who work hard to make our home a special place to live. We have much to be proud of here in West Salem. Did you know we actually have seven parks in West Salem? We have the Village Square which has been the center of activity for longer than any of us can remember. Many have fond memories of the Free Shows on Saturday evenings in the summer. There is Centennial Park, the ball park, which was established during the Village’s Centennial Celebration in 1957. The Mill Pond Park is better known as the tennis court park. It recently underwent a makeover thanks to the citizens of West Salem working under the leadership of the West Salem Development Association. Finally, there are the four corners which was named Central Park in our early years. Each corner at the intersection of Church Street and Albion Street is a park. Originally given to the Village by the Moravian Church, many are unaware that these areas are parks.
